Common problems that necessitate Samsung AC repair include insufficient cooling, unusual noises, water leakage, frozen coils, and complete system failure. Each of these symptoms can indicate different underlying issues. For instance, inadequate cooling might result from dirty filters, low refrigerant levels, or compressor problems. Strange noises often point to mechanical issues with fans or motors. Water leakage typically indicates clogged drain lines or improper installation. Before calling a professional for Samsung AC repair, there are several troubleshooting steps you can take:
- Check the power supply and ensure the unit is properly plugged in
- Verify that the thermostat is set correctly and functioning
- Inspect and clean or replace dirty air filters
- Clear any debris around the outdoor unit
- Ensure all vents are open and unobstructed
- Check the circuit breaker for tripped switches
These simple steps can resolve many common issues without the need for professional Samsung AC repair services. However, if problems persist, it’s time to consider more advanced solutions.
Regular maintenance is crucial for minimizing the need for extensive Samsung AC repair. A well-maintained system typically requires fewer repairs and operates more efficiently. Key maintenance tasks include cleaning or replacing filters monthly during peak usage seasons, keeping the outdoor unit clear of debris, scheduling professional tune-ups twice a year, checking refrigerant levels annually, and ensuring proper airflow throughout your home. Investing in preventive maintenance can significantly reduce the likelihood of major Samsung AC repair needs.

The cost of Samsung AC repair varies depending on several factors, including the specific problem, your location, the age of your unit, and whether parts need replacement. Minor repairs like capacitor replacement or thermostat issues might cost between $100-$300, while major components like compressor replacement can range from $1,000-$2,500. Many Samsung AC repair providers offer free estimates, so it’s wise to get multiple quotes before proceeding with major repairs. Consider the age of your unit when evaluating repair costs – if your system is over 10 years old and requires significant repairs, replacement might be more cost-effective than extensive Samsung AC repair.
Understanding warranty coverage is essential when dealing with Samsung AC repair. Most Samsung units come with limited warranties that cover specific components for varying periods. Compressors typically have 5-10 year warranties, while other parts may have 1-5 year coverage. Note that improper maintenance or unauthorized repairs can void your warranty, so always check warranty terms before attempting DIY fixes or hiring uncertified technicians. For units still under warranty, contact Samsung directly for authorized repair services to maintain coverage.

Environmental factors also influence Samsung AC repair needs. Units in coastal areas may experience corrosion from salt air, while systems in dusty environments require more frequent filter changes and coil cleaning. Humidity levels affect how hard your system works and can impact component wear. A knowledgeable Samsung AC repair technician will understand how local environmental conditions affect your system and can recommend appropriate maintenance schedules and protective measures.
